1 / 10

Agile Software Development

This project focuses on developing an Agile Software Development framework for managing user stories in a communications engineering context. It allows different roles including Consultants, Managers, Controllers, and Directors to manage activities through functionalities such as login, CRUD operations, and user management. The system provides insights on user activity, workload calculations, and activity status. Key features include customizable dashboards, real-time updates, and notifications about activity progress. Join us as we explore innovative solutions to enhance project management within tech environments.

saniya
Télécharger la présentation

Agile Software Development

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Lappeenranta University of Technology Department of Communication Software Code Camp on Communications Engineering CT30A9300 Agile Software Development SaeedMirzaeifar Yasir Ali Zahid Butt

  2. Problem  Idea!!!

  3. Basic Requirement

  4. Agile Development  Scrum

  5. User Story • as a consultant I can login • as consultant I can create activities • as consultant I can Update activities • as consultant I can delete activities • as a consultant I can read, delete messages sanded by controller. • as a Admin I can create users, users are MANAGER,CONTROLLER,CONSULTANT,DIRECTOR. • as a manager I can login • as a manager I can edit activities of consultant. • as a manager I can assign activities to other consultant. • as a manager I can view activities of consultant • as a manager I can find available consultant • as a controller I can login • as a controller I can CRUD messages • as a controller I can send messages to users • as a director I can login • as a director I can view single activity details • system should display calculation of consultant monthly hours(probability) • system should display calculation of consultant Total work load monthly. • system should display calculation of activity total hourly price for week and month • system should display which activity is done. • system should display how much time is left for activity to be completed

  6. Week sprints:

  7. Sprints

  8. DataBase Design:

  9. Implementation  Demo

  10. Thank you ! Questions???!!!!

More Related